Output 26f9f15794487c588c53b30bdb1c01c904e267ffb7f8dd5e3ec19e16c94c9ca1:2

value
530475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b1d13e41ba3e383eaa6f7701b492b913758cde OP_EQUAL
address
3B41s5RA8pfJPb3dYBL3ct4brxLifLyjVf
transaction
26f9f15794487c588c53b30bdb1c01c904e267ffb7f8dd5e3ec19e16c94c9ca1
confirmations
150663
spent
true